Concrete steps afoot to improving cleanliness in Quetta: Administrator

QUETTA: Shoukat Ali, Administrator, Quetta Metropolitan Corporation (QMC), has said that concrete measures were being adopted to ensure improving cleanliness in Quetta city. These views were expressed by him while talking to media, including PPI, during inspection of different areas of the provincial capital on Friday. He said, “Quetta city is like our home, hence, it becomes our duty and responsibility to take care of its cleanliness”.

He added that directions to all the concerned authorities of QMC had already been issued to remain vigilant during the recent rainy season in order to cope up with any untoward situation. He said sanitary staff of QMC had been deployed in different areas of the city to carry out cleanliness, adding that he was personally supervising the duties of staff. During visit of Jinnah Road, Anscomb Road, Circular Road, Meezan Chowk, Qandhari Bazar, Zarghoon Road, Nawa Killi, Sariab Road and other area of Quetta, he directed the deputed staff to perform their duties diligently so that people might not confront hardships. He said that strict disciplinary proceedings against the negligent staff would be initiated in accordance with the rules in vogue.

Moreover, in compliance with the directives of Shoukat Ali, Administrator, QMC, Attaullah Baloch, Chief Metropolitan Officer, QMC suspended the services of two sanitary staff on account of negligence. Among the suspended staff included, Nathail Akhtar, Sanitary Inspector and Ali Muhammad son of Bahawal Khan, Sanitary Supervisor
